All Flying: All flying as set forth in Section 2 [Definitions –
Flight Pay], now or hereafter conducted by, or which hereafter
becomes available to the Company (including utilization of
aircraft under the operational control of the Company) shall, if
flown by the Company, continue to be performed by Pilots on
the Alaska Airlines Pilot System Seniority List. This places a
mutual obligation on the Company and the Pilots.
Flight Pay: means hourly, international and other credited pay on
scheduled, extra sections, and the following non-scheduled flights:
publicity, charters, contract, scenic, attempts, rerouted flights,
instruction, check flying, ferries, engine, instrument, plane and
radio test flights, experimental and airway aid test or proving flights
for which Pilots receive pay in accordance with pay differentials
outlined in this Agreement.
